As pp, BOMA does not have a lunch seating. It is one of our favorite restaurants and we make it there every vacation but do yourself a favor and make reservations. The soups are amazing and so is the banana bread pudding with vanilla sauce! Everything from the carving stations to the sides are delicious and there is also a section of standard food for kids. Boma doesn't serve lunch, breakfast and dinner only. I usually plan dinner there early, as that's one restaurant that seems to get very busy and backed up quickly, but it's well worth the wait.
